When a professional is employed to analyze a mobile phone lawfully, they follow a strenuous procedure. Digital forensics is the application of science to the identification, collection, evaluation, and analysis of data while preserving the stability of the info.
The Forensic Process:Seizure and Isolation: The device is positioned in a "Faraday bag" to avoid remote wiping or signals from reaching it.Acquisition: Using specific hardware, a "bit-by-bit" copy of the phone's memory is made.Analysis: Experts search for deleted files, concealed partitions, and communication logs.Reporting: A last file is prepared that can be used in a court of law, describing exactly how the information was retrieved.5. Mobile Vulnerabilities Professionals Address
Employing a security expert is typically done to fix vulnerabilities instead of exploit them. Professionals look for several key weak points in mobile phones:
Operating System Vulnerabilities: Outdated variations of Android or iOS might have "Zero-day" vulnerabilities.Unsecured Public Wi-Fi: Devices can be intercepted by "Man-in-the-Middle" (MitM) attacks.Destructive Applications: Sideloaded apps which contain spyware or keyloggers.SIM Swapping: A social engineering attack where a hacker encourages a provider to change a phone number to a new SIM card.6. How to Properly Secure a Mobile Device
Rather of hiring someone to repair a breach after it happens, avoidance is the very best technique. Experts advise a multi-layered technique to mobile security.
Security Checklist for Users:Enable Biometrics and Strong Passcodes: Use Hire A Reliable Hacker minimum of a 6-digit PIN or long hardware-backed passwords.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Always use app-based authenticators (like Google Authenticator) instead of SMS-based 2FA.Regular Updates: Install security patches immediately upon release.VPN Usage: Use a credible Virtual Private Network when accessing public networks.App Permissions: Regularly audit which apps have access to your microphone, camera, and area.8.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Is it legal to hire a hacker to access somebody else's phone?
No. In the majority of jurisdictions, accessing a gadget or account that you do not own and do not have explicit permission to access is an offense of personal privacy laws, such as the Computer Fraud and Abuse Act (CFAA) in the United States.

Q3: Can a professional recover "vanishing" messages from apps like Signal or Telegram?
It depends. While these apps use end-to-end file encryption, if the messages were not overwritten in the physical memory of the gadget, a forensic specialist might have the ability to recuperate "pieces" of the information through physical extraction.
Q4: How can I tell if my phone has been hacked?
Signs consist of quick battery drain, the phone fuming regardless of no use, mysterious data use spikes, or apps opening and closing on their own. If you presume this, a security professional can run a diagnostic to examine for spyware.
Q5: What accreditations should I look for in a mobile security professional?
Try to find acknowledged market accreditations such as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H), Cellebrite Certified Operator (CCO), or GIAC iOS and Android Forensics (GASF).
